Understanding Umbrella Company Structures in Relation to IR35
Umbrella companies have emerged as a common framework for independent contractors within the UK, particularly in sectors such as Software development. These entities function by employing contractors and then supplying them to various clients on temporary assignments. However, the advent of IR35 legislation has brought significant nuances to this arrangement, aiming to ensure that contractors operating through umbrella companies are correctly classified for tax purposes. IR35 seeks to deter individuals from being treated as self-employed while effectively working like employees, thereby ensuring they pay the appropriate level of national insurance and income tax.
- Consequently, it is crucial for contractors to understand the intricate relationship between umbrella company structures and IR35 legislation.
- This involves carefully evaluating their working practices, contracts, and the specific arrangements offered by the umbrella company they choose to work with.

Navigating Tax Implications and Responsibilities: Umbrella Companies and IR35
When engaging as a contractor in the UK, it's crucial to comprehend the complexities of tax responsibilities. Two key factors that often come into play are umbrella companies and IR35. Umbrella companies offer a systematic framework for contractors, handling payment calculations and revenue compliance. IR35, on the other hand, is a set of regulations designed to avoid tax avoidance by individuals who work through their own limited companies.
Understanding the connection between these two elements is critical for contractors to ensure they are meeting their tax obligations. Omission to do so can result in penalties, including back taxes and interest charges.
- Seeking professional guidance from an accountant or tax specialist is highly advised for contractors to navigate the complexities of umbrella companies and IR35.
